💥 Attack

A nighttime drone (UAV) attack caused a fire at the Tuapse oil refinery in Krasnodar Krai, Russia. The fire was extinguished by regional police.

Tuapse, Krasnodar Krai

Ukrinform → Source tone: certain

A fire broke out at the Tuapse oil refinery following an UAV attack

Kyiv Independent → Source tone: certain

The drones were reportedly launched from the Russian port town of Primorsko-Akhtarsk, located on the coast of the Sea of Azov, and from Russia's Kursk Oblast.

Kyiv Post → Source tone: likely

The Security Service of Ukraine (SBU) and the Main Intelligence Directorate of the Ministry of Defense (HUR) are behind the massive drone attack on Russian regions targeting oil depots in occupied Sevastopol and cities of Tuapse and Novorossiysk

UNIAN → Source tone: certain

Ukrainian drones attacked the oil refinery in Tuapse on May 17, 2024. Local residents filmed the moment of impact and air defense operations.

Censor.NET → Source tone: likely

Ukrainian drones attacked Tuapse oil refinery again, forcing shutdown after fire.
